Meaning
Olive oil packaging refers to the process of enclosing olive oil in suitable containers or packaging materials for transportation, storage, and sale. It involves the selection of appropriate packaging formats, such as bottles, cans, pouches, or tins, along with labels and closures that ensure product integrity and provide essential information to consumers.

Regional Analysis
The olive oil packaging market exhibits regional variations in terms of consumption patterns, packaging preferences, and market dynamics. Some key regional insights include:
- Europe: Europe is a significant consumer and producer of olive oil, driving the demand for packaging solutions. Glass bottles are commonly used in the European market due to their perceived quality and traditional association with olive oil.
- North America: The growing awareness of the health benefits of olive oil has led to an increase in its consumption in North America. The market in this region is characterized by a preference for premium packaging formats, such as dark-colored glass bottles.
- Asia Pacific: The Asia Pacific region is witnessing a surge in demand for olive oil due to the influence of western cuisine, changing dietary preferences, and a rising awareness of the health benefits of olive oil. The market in this region offers substantial growth potential for olive oil packaging.
- Middle East and Africa: Olive oil is a staple ingredient in Middle Eastern and North African cuisines. Traditional packaging formats, such as tin cans or glass bottles, are prevalent in these regions.

Category-wise Insights
Different categories within the olive oil packaging market offer unique insights:
- Glass Bottles:
- Glass bottles are widely preferred for packaging olive oil due to their ability to protect the oil from light and oxygen, preserving its quality.
- Dark-colored glass bottles, such as amber or green, are commonly used to minimize light exposure and maintain the oil’s freshness.
- Plastic Bottles:
- Plastic bottles offer convenience, lightweight properties, and shatter resistance, making them suitable for various retail and foodservice applications.
- Manufacturers are increasingly focusing on eco-friendly plastic alternatives, such as bio-based or recycled plastics, to address sustainability concerns.
- Metal Cans:
- Metal cans provide excellent protection against external factors and are often used for bulk packaging or industrial applications.
- Tin-plated steel cans are commonly used in the olive oil packaging industry, offering robustness and preserving the oil’s shelf life.
- Flexible Pouches:
- Pouches provide flexibility, cost-effectiveness, and lightweight properties, making them suitable for single-serve or on-the-go applications.
- The adoption of stand-up pouches with spouts or resealable closures is increasing, offering convenience and ensuring product freshness.

Market Key Trends
The olive oil packaging market is characterized by several key trends:
- Sustainable packaging solutions: The industry is witnessing a growing demand for environmentally friendly packaging materials and designs. Manufacturers are adopting biodegradable, compostable, and recycled materials to meet sustainability goals.
- Premium packaging formats: Consumers are increasingly inclined towards premium packaging formats, such as elegant glass bottles or custom-designed packaging, to enhance product appeal and perceived quality.
- Single-serve packaging: The trend of single-serve or portion-controlled packaging is gaining popularity due to its convenience and suitability for on-the-go consumption. Sachets, small bottles, or individual pouches cater to changing consumer preferences.
- Smart packaging and labeling: The integration of smart packaging technologies, such as QR codes, NFC tags, or freshness indicators, provides enhanced functionality and consumer engagement opportunities.
